3. Tape — amber
Off: no fault has been detected
Flashing: The cartridge currently in the drive is faulty (damaged or unsupported) or an attempt was
made to write to a write-protected tape. To determine if the tape is a supported generation, write-
protected, or has physical damage, inspect the cartridge. If physical damage is noted, discard the
cartridge.
4. Clean — amber
On: cleaning cartridge in use
Off: the drive does not require cleaning
Flashing: the drive needs cleaning
5. Encryption — blue
On: at power-on
Off: some or all the data on the tape is not encrypted
On: all data on the tape is encrypted
On with Ready LED flashing: drive is reading/writing encrypted data and all data on the cartridge is
encrypted
Flashing: encryption or decryption error
